How to Clean the Pans

If pan overgrown with a thick layer of fat or soot, do not despair. To do it this way: in a basin of water cut more soap boil and put the dishes for 15 minutes. Then let it cool in a bowl, scrub with steel wool or fine brush.

Frying pans can be cleaned this way: a little warm up and wipe their salt Then parchment or plain white paper.
Odor fish can be removed if rubbed pan all the same salt, then rinse.
